Sandbox Universe
时间: 2024-01-10 08:04:09 浏览: 29
我理解你的问题是关于“Sandbox Universe”的。那么,Sandbox Universe是什么意思呢?一般情况下,sandbox可以解释为沙盒,而Universe可以解释为宇宙。因此,Sandbox Universe通常指的是沙盒宇宙,也可以理解为一个虚拟的、被隔离出来的环境,其中可以进行实验或测试。在计算机科学领域,Sandbox Universe通常被用于安全测试或运行不可信代码,以避免对系统或数据的潜在风险。
相关问题
iframe sandbox
iframe 是 HTML 中的一个元素,用于在当前页面中嵌入另一个页面。sandbox 属性是 iframe 的一个特性,用于设置嵌入的页面的安全策略。
sandbox 属性可以接受以下值:
- "allow-forms":允许嵌入的页面包含表单元素。
- "allow-modals":允许嵌入的页面使用模态对话框。
- "allow-orientation-lock":允许嵌入的页面锁定屏幕方向。
- "allow-pointer-lock":允许嵌入的页面锁定鼠标指针。
- "allow-popups":允许嵌入的页面弹出新窗口。
- "allow-popups-to-escape-sandbox":允许嵌入的页面通过 target="_blank" 打开新窗口。
- "allow-presentation":允许嵌入的页面使用全屏模式进行演示。
- "allow-same-origin":允许嵌入的页面与父页面拥有相同的源,即同源策略。
- "allow-scripts":允许嵌入的页面运行脚本。
- "allow-top-navigation":允许嵌入的页面导航到顶级窗口。
sandbox 属性也可以通过多个值的组合来设置多个策略,例如:sandbox="allow-scripts allow-forms"。这将允许嵌入的页面运行脚本和包含表单元素。
使用 sandbox 属性可以提高对嵌入页面的安全性,限制其对父页面和其他资源的访问权限,防止恶意代码的执行和数据泄露。
Security sandbox
安全沙箱(Security sandbox)是一种安全机制,用于限制程序或应用程序在执行过程中对计算机系统的访问权限。它通过创建一个受控环境,将程序的运行限制在该环境中,从而防止恶意代码对系统进行损坏或滥用。
安全沙箱主要通过以下几种方式来实现:
1. 权限限制:安全沙箱会限制程序对操作系统资源的访问权限,例如文件系统、网络连接和系统配置等。这样可以防止程序读取、修改或删除敏感数据,以及进行未经授权的系统操作。
2. 内存隔离:安全沙箱会为每个程序分配一个独立的内存空间,防止程序越界访问其他进程的内存。这可以有效防止缓冲区溢出等内存安全问题。
3. 代码验证:安全沙箱会对程序的代码进行验证和审查,以确保其不包含恶意代码或漏洞。这可以防止恶意程序利用安全漏洞进行攻击。
4. 输入过滤:安全沙箱会对程序接收的输入进行过滤和验证,以防止恶意输入导致的安全漏洞,如跨站脚本攻击(XSS)或SQL注入攻击。
5. 日志记录和监控:安全沙箱会记录程序的行为和系统的状态,并监控其活动。这可以帮助检测和分析潜在的安全问题,以及及时采取相应的应对措施。